> > such a tool has been there for a long while; it's called "gnue-gsdgen".
> > This tool creates GNUe Schema Definitions (.gsd files) from the
> 
> This is a another thing; I needed *data* dumps and this is just what
> I've do.
> 
> > appserver's internal gnue_* structure. It takes an arbitrary number of
> > module-names and classnames as argument and creats a gsd-file optionally
> > including schema-information, data-information or both.
> > 
> > I've posted the new versions of gnue-schema and gnue-gcd2sql yesterday.
> > These tools can now communicate with the backend directly so creating
> > and updating schema- and classrepository-information should be straigth
> > forward now.
> > 
> > Probably I'll create a tool for creating gsd-data-dumps of arbitrary
> > datatables from the backend after my holidays (which start on thursday),
> > but this seems to introduce another bunch of 'sort-problems' (regarding
> > constraints and the like).
